What went well in sprint

In the latest sprint, our team achieved remarkable milestones and showcased exceptional performance. The collaborative efforts of each member played a pivotal role in driving the project forward. This article highlights the key aspects that went well during the sprint, emphasizing the team’s dedication and commitment to delivering high-quality results.

1. Clear Objectives and Prioritization

The sprint began with a well-defined set of objectives, ensuring that everyone was on the same page. By prioritizing tasks based on their importance and impact, we were able to focus on delivering the most valuable features first. This approach not only helped in meeting the project’s goals but also minimized the risk of scope creep.

2. Effective Communication

Throughout the sprint, our team maintained open and transparent communication channels. Regular meetings, updates, and feedback sessions facilitated smooth coordination among team members. This effective communication helped in resolving any issues promptly and ensured that everyone was aligned with the project’s progress.

3. Collaborative Approach

The success of the sprint can be attributed to the collaborative spirit within the team. Each member actively contributed their expertise and skills, fostering a culture of innovation and creativity. By leveraging each other’s strengths, we were able to tackle complex challenges and come up with effective solutions.

4. Efficient Task Management

Our team employed a robust task management system to keep track of progress and ensure timely completion of tasks. Regular updates and progress reports enabled us to stay on top of the project’s status and make necessary adjustments whenever required. This efficient task management approach minimized delays and helped in meeting the sprint deadlines.

5. Continuous Learning and Improvement

The sprint provided an opportunity for continuous learning and improvement. By reflecting on our strengths and weaknesses, we identified areas for enhancement and took proactive measures to address them. This culture of continuous improvement not only helped in delivering a high-quality product but also contributed to the personal growth of each team member.

6. Client Satisfaction

The positive outcomes of the sprint were not limited to the team alone; our clients were equally delighted with the progress made. The successful delivery of key features and the timely resolution of their concerns resulted in increased satisfaction and trust. This client-centric approach played a crucial role in the sprint’s success.
